Popular Health Tests in Bearsden

Full Blood Count (FBC)

Checks red cells, white cells, and platelets to identify anaemia, infection, or immune imbalance. Common for Bearsden residents experiencing ongoing fatigue or frequent illness.

Thyroid Function Test

Measures TSH and other thyroid hormones that influence metabolism and mood. Useful when fatigue, weight changes, or low mood appear.

Vitamin D Test

Assesses vitamin D levels, which frequently drop across Scotland due to reduced sunlight during autumn and winter.

Diabetes Blood Test

Evaluates glucose levels to detect early diabetes. Often chosen by adults with family history or lifestyle risk factors.

Ferritin Blood Test

Reviews iron storage levels to help investigate tiredness, breathlessness, or hair thinning.

Cholesterol Blood Test

Monitors LDL, HDL, and triglycerides to assess heart health and cardiovascular risk.

Choosing the Right Test

Tiredness or low mood – Thyroid, Vitamin D, or Ferritin

Weight changes – Metabolism or Hormone profile

Digestive discomfort – Food Intolerance or Coeliac test

Family heart history – Cholesterol profile

Thirst or frequent urination – Diabetes test

Cycle or fertility concerns – Female Hormone or Fertility test

Training and performance – Testosterone or General Health profile
